What's Happening?
Logan Gilbert, a pitcher for the Seattle Mariners, delivered an impressive performance against the San Francisco Giants, striking out 10 batters over six innings. This effort contributed to the Mariners' victory, with Gilbert allowing only three runs
on four hits and a walk. His consistent performance over recent games has been notable, as he has pitched at least six innings in seven consecutive starts. This consistency has been a key factor in the Mariners' recent successes, with Gilbert maintaining a 3.38 ERA and a 0.98 WHIP over 120 innings this season.
